A poison pill can make a company's shares unfavorable to an acquiring firm and raise the cost of purchasing the firm. This can be beneficial in keeping a company away, but it can also hurt the company in that it may deter other investors.

What Is a Poison Pill? A poison pill is a defense strategy used by the directors of a public company to prevent activist investors, competitors, or other would-be acquirers from taking control of the company. Poison pills are executed by buying up large amounts of its stock.

Summary. Shareholder rights plans, or poison pills, are measures that a company may implement to discourage a hostile takeover. A poison pill does not always mean that companies do not want to be acquired. Sometimes they are used to force the acquirer to negotiate takeover terms more favorable for the target company.

A poison pill is a corporate defense strategy against hostile takeover attempts. The name is derived from the poison pills that Cold War-era spies kept to commit suicide if caught. The name has an obvious negative connotation and for good reason.

A poison pill is designed to discourage a major acquisition of shares and a company's hostile takeover by an individual or entity. Once activated, the strategy allows shareholders, with the exception of the acquiring party, to buy additional shares of company stock at a highly discounted price.

Yes, poison pills strategies allow shareholders to enjoy immediate profits when they purchase new stock at a discount. However, poison pills result in diluted stock values, so if shareholders want to maintain proportionate ownership in the company, they must buy additional stock to keep up.

The term poison pill refers to a defensive technique used by a target firm to avoid or deter an acquiring business from taking the risk of a hostile takeover. Prospective targets use this strategy to make the potential acquirer appear less appealing to them.
